Infrastructure Work Kicks Off $5B Vermont All-Season Resort Expansion

ENR Construction

The full buildout of the masterplan envisions building 2,300 residential units. The town plans to spend nearly $87 million in two phases over 10 years building a new municipal water system and reconstructing Killington Rd., the access road to the ski resort that 5,000 vehicles use daily in winter, says Sherman.
